Pakistani Rupee (PKR) remains stable against US Dollar – July 22, 2025

KARACHI: On July 22, 2025, the US Dollar to Pakistani Rupee (PKR) exchange rate was recorded at Rs 288.3 in the open market, with a selling rate of Rs 288.6. According to Interbank, the US Dollar to Pakistani Rupee interbank exchange rate is Rs 282.15.

The US Dollar (USD) remained unchanged compared to its previous closing price of Rs284.
